Re: New GRE
The Graduate Record Examination (GRE) is a standardized test. It is an admissions requirement for most graduate schools in the United States. Graduate Record Examination (GRE) New pattern The GRE New Pattern has three sections: Verbal Reasoning – The GRE Verbal Reasoning section tests your ability to analyze any written material and extract information from it. The Verbal Reasoning section has the following parts :- 1. Reading Comprehension 2. Text Completion 3. Sentence Equivalence The GRE New Pattern has 2 Verbal reasoning sections – 20 Questions & 30 minutes per section. The scoring is done on a scale of 130 to 170, with 1 point increments. Quantitative Reasoning – It covers basic mathematical skills like arithmetic concepts, geometry, algebra, probability and statistics. The GRE New Pattern has 2 Quantitative reasoning sections – 20 Questions & 35 minutes per section. The scoring is done on a scale of 130 to 170, with 1 point increments. Analytical Writing – The GRE Analytical Writing tests your critical thinking and analytical writing skills. There are 2 types of Analytical Writing Essays in GRE New Pattern:- 1. Issue-Task essay 2.
